The GadgetXchange reviews are pretty high rated with their services and you can get paid either via gift card or by cheque if you choose. The way the payment process works is pretty quick and painless as long as you provided the correct information on your gadget. If the engineers who inspect the gadget find nothing wrong with it then the amount you were promised will be sent out to you. However, if GadgetXchange do find that the item is faulty or less valuable then you will be notified and given a new cash offer.
